Game Developer’s Conference is a success
March 15, 2010 • Steven Markowitz ('10)/ Eastside Underground Editor
The Game Developer’s Conference is a gaming expo exclusively for game developers to share their advice, secrets and announce some games for the public. The conference took place March 9 to March 13 at the Moscone Center in San Francisco, CA. In addition to many keynote speeches covering a wide range... Read more »

District 9 review
March 7, 2010 • Dillon Rosenblatt ('11)/Eastside Editorial Assistant
Aliens have finally reached Earth, arriving in a spaceship directly over Johannesburg. Found inside, starving to death, are the aliens (called prawns) who benefit from a humanitarian desire to relocate them to a location on the ground. The place they live is called District 9.
